10. Lamp Out Alert Indicator
For remote monitoring of the UV lamp status, the Lamp Out Alert feature is
available. When one or more lamps are out, a SPDT contact is available for
customer interfacing during Lamp Out condition.
interfacing into a central monitoring system (PLC, DCS, etc).
During the lamp out fault condition, the Lamp Out Alert indicator lamp will
illuminate RED. The Lamp Out Alert is equipped with a 30 second time delay.
During the first 30 seconds of operation, the circuit will ignore any lamp out
condition. The delay allows time for the proper warm up of the lamps and
prevents false alarm conditions.
Depending upon the system design, a lamp(s) out condition may require an
immediate action. In single or multiple lamp units, if one or more lamps are
out, the water may not get treated properly. This will be based upon sizing of
the equipment and if any redundancy is built into the system. Therefore, in a
Lamp Out condition, the action of the operator will be based upon the overall
design.

Setting the SET 100% LEVEL

1) To set the SET 100% LEVEL, the initial value (100%) should be set.
2) The unit should be operating under normal operating conditions (flow,
temperature) with new lamps and clean quartz sleeves.
3) The Aqualogic 2000™ should be set to read the "RELATIVE" mode by
switching DIPswitch SW7-8 to the "CLOSED" position.
4) The SW3 button then should be pressed. A beep should be heard which
indicates that the 100% intensity has been set into the memory.
Switching the DIPswitch SW7-8 into the "OPEN" position will register the
100% intensity value in µW/cm
Setting Low UV Alarm Level:
1) DIPswitch SW7-1 sets the low UV ALARM SET point.
2) For HX units, DIP switch SW-7 should be set to the "CLOSED" position
(80%).
3) When the relative UV level indicates 80% (or when 80% of the 100% level
of the absolute intensity), the LOW-level alarm lamp will illuminate RED
and the audio alarm will sound for 30 seconds.
The UV ALARM SET point must be set with all UV lamps operating.
NOTE: Resetting the 100% value must be performed after the first 100 hours of operation on new
UV lamps, both at the time of installation and each time the UV lamps are replaced.
